General Dynamics Mission Systems Advanced Software Test System Engineer LabWindows / C in Canonsburg, Pennsylvania

Reference #: 2025-65748 Basic Qualifications Requires a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, or a related Science, Engineering or Mathematics field. Also requires 5+ years of job-related experience, or a Master's degree plus 3 years of job-related experience. CLEARANCE REQUIREMENTS: Department of Defense Secret security clearance is preferred at time of hire, but must be obtainable within a reasonable period of time as determined by program requirements. Applicants selected may be subject to a U.S. Government security investigation and must meet eligibility requirements for access to classified information. Due to the nature of work performed within our facilities, U.S. citizenship is required. Responsibilities for this Position General Dynamics Mission Systems is currently seeking an Advanced Software Test System Engineer - LabWindows / C (Adv Software Eng) in our Canonburg, PA facility.

Progeny Systems, a business area within the General Dynamics Mission Systems company, is a high-tech business focusing on software and hardware system integration, cutting-edge research and development, and manufacturing. We deliver architectures, designs, testing, and production of the current and next generation torpedo guidance and control systems for the Department of Defense providing the warfighter with advanced capabilities in target detection, acquisition, and prosecution. We are a technology leader in numerous areas including technology insertion; acoustic sensors; signal processing; guidance; cyber secure; and high reliability systems.Duties and Tasks: This position will involve the design, development, testing, integration and configuration of software applications and components as well as engineering expertise in diagnostics/debugging issues in existing code. You will collaborate across the functional teams to resolve issues and recommend solutions to ensure that your Software and the system meets requirements with the performance needed for deployment. Strong problem-solving and communication skills In addition, this position will require the documentation of software development including development of test plans, design documentation, and maintaining design requirements.
